Depreciation Reports

Independent depreciation reports that identify major building components, assess their expected service life, and forecast long-term repair and replacement costs. Our reports support informed budgeting and capital planning for strata corporations across coastal BC.

Property Condition Assessments (PCA)

Property condition assessments provide a comprehensive snapshot of a building’s current condition, highlighting deficiencies, risks, and near-term priorities. They are commonly used for due diligence, pre-purchase reviews, and strategic maintenance planning.

Capital Asset Replacement Plans (CARP)

Capital asset replacement plans translate technical building information into clear, long-term renewal strategies and funding models. These plans help owners prioritize major maintenance, align expenditures with asset condition, and manage capital risk over time.
